Program Summary

The Dallas Green Building Program establishes expedited permitting for green buildings. During Phase 1 of the program (October 1, 2009 - September 30, 2011), applicants must provide a checklist from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ED) , Green Built Texas, or any other approved green building standard. The checklist must show that the project is eligible to obtain a certification under LEED standards. Beginning October 1, 2013 (Phase 2), all project applicants must provide a checklist that shows that the project is eligible for LEED Silver or higher. Applicants may use another approved green building standard during this phase as well. Applicants do not actually have to register or certify their projects with the green building standard they have selected, but simply demonstrate that their projects would qualify.
